So today I had the (if I do say so myself...) BRILLIANT idea for a quick yummy smoothie. I JUST had to share it :)
I am a huge fan of anything strawberry and banana so naturally I made a strawberry banana smoothie :)
Recipe:
1/4 cup vanilla yogurt
1/2 cup filled with frozen strawberry and bananas
1/2 cup milk
1 teaspoon of honey
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
blend in the blender and pour into your favorite cup!
If you want... Add a scoop of your protein powder.
It is quite delicious!!
These are the ingredients I used...
and of course.. Honey!
NOW is when the brilliance kicks in... (OK OK I cannot take ALLl the credit.. I did see this on pineterest... but that will be our little secret) I don't know about you but I do not have a lot of time. So to take the time to measure out everything then blend it then clean up... it can take up to a good 10-15 minutes. I don't have that kind of time during the day and in between classes. So I took the time (30 min!) to "pre package" everything! It saves so much time during the week when I want to make a healthy smoothie.
Here we go!
Take a muffin sheet and make sure it is clean.
Take your 1/4 measuring cup and fill the muffin pan with the yogurt and pop it in the freezer.
I then took 1/2 a cup of strawberries and bananas and put it in a freezer ziplock baggie. I wanted for the yogurt to freeze. After about 2 hours I got the yogurt out and put them in the bags with the frozen fruit. Then BAM all you have to do is take out your ziplock bag filled with yogurt and frozen fruit and add 1/2 cup of milk and a teaspoon of honey into the blender and blend away! Add some protein powder if you would like. It only takes about 2 minutes!
It is yummy and fast! Perfect for busy students on the go!
This can work for any smoothie flavor (blueberry, mixed berry, etc) so please let me know if you have any other yummy smoothie recipes!
